Quilon

Quilon is a lightweight and flexible library that automates the generation of Entity-Relationship Diagrams (ERD) from your application’s entities. Thanks to its architecture, it allows for easy extension to support additional ORMs and diagramming languages in the future.

Supported ORMs and Diagram Languages

ORM Supported
TypeORM
Diagram Language Supported
Mermaid

Installation

npm install quilon

Usage

Init

npx quilon init

This creates a pre-configured quilon.json in the root of your project. Out of the box it looks like this:

{
  "$schema": "https://raw.githubusercontent.com/quilon-tool/quilon/main/src/config/config-schema.json",
  "entities": [],
  "orm": "TypeORM",
  "diagramLanguage": "Mermaid",
  "outputDir": "./diagrams"
}

To kick things off, add files or directories to the entities Array:

{
  "$schema": "https://raw.githubusercontent.com/quilon-tool/quilon/main/src/config/config-schema.json",
  "entities": ["myentity.ts", "./src/entities"],
  "orm": "TypeORM",
  "diagramLanguage": "Mermaid",
  "outputDir": "./diagrams"
}

Now, Quilon is ready to read your provided entity files and convert them into the specified diagram language.


Generate

To generate the code in the specific diagram language:

npx quilon generate

This will generate a new erd file in the given diagram language inside the ./diagrams directory in the root of your project.
